The opportunity of agribusiness palm oil plantation related to the increased of plam oil demand in the world. The business of palm oil plantation in Indonesia now is facing the limited land resources. Development of palm oil plantation to sub optimals lands such as acid sulphate soils were estimated in 2.0 millions hectares in Indonesia. The palm oil cultures in acid sulphate soils need the appropriate of inputs and efficiency based in land characteristics. Glass house experiments was conducted with randomized complete designs with three replications. An experiments consisted of two sub aactivities i.e combination of NPK dosage with humic matterial application methods. Each treatment consisted 30 plant/polybag so that totals 720 plants/polybag, Sub activity 1 (Humic matterial coated on NPK fertilizers) : a) 100 % NPK + no humic coating 0 % , b) 100 % NPK + humic coated 0,5 %, c) 75 % NPK + humic coated 1,0 %, d) 50% NPK + humic coated 2%. Humic applicated in % (v/w). Sub activities 2 (application of humic liquid was sprayed). : were kind of four of treatments (1) 100 % NPK 100 % with out humic, (2) 100 % NPK + humic (liquid) 3 cc/plant, (3) 75 % NPK + Humic (liquid) 3 cc/plant, and (4) 50% NPK + humic (liquid) 6 cc/plant.. Application of humic was sprayed suited in on each treatments 20 times equivalent 1 – 2 liters, humic acid was diluted in 20 l water was applicatid in polybags eachs 3 – 4 weeks. Parameter were observed in soil chemical characteristics before planting, plants growth (plant height, plant diameters and leaf numbers per plant) and leaf macronutrient contents such as N, P, K, Ca and Mg. Data were collected by using variant analized. Differents of the treatments were tested by DMRT0.05. Result showed that (1) Fertilizer appplied 75% NPK recommended + liquid humic 1% (v/w) (coated) better than to increase of plant height, plant diameters and leaf numbers of palm oil at 6 and 7 month ago compared to others.(2) Applicaton of 75% NPK with sprayed 3 cc humic per plant will increased the plant height most, plant diameters and leaf numbers at age of 6 and 7 month ago than the others. (3) Applivcation of humic matter 1% (v/w) (coated) at 75 % NPK better than application of 75 % NPK applied + humic (liquid) 3 cc per plant that was sprayed in the soil polybag on plant height, diameter plant and number of leaf per plant and to increase of N, P and K content of the plant.
